
Cefkri-AZ Tablet
Marketer
Krishgir Pharmaceuticals Pvt Ltd
Salt Composition
Cefixime (200mg) + Azithromycin (250mg) + Lactobacillus (60Million spores)
Overview Cefkri-AZ Tablet
Azithromycin-Cefixime tablets are a dual-action antibiotic combating diverse bacterial infections. This medication inhibits bacterial proliferation and prevents infection spread, simultaneously mitigating the risk of associated diarrhea. Always use as prescribed by a physician. Administration may coincide with or precede meals, but consistent timing is crucial for optimal therapeutic outcome. Exceeding the recommended dosage can be detrimental. Missed doses should be taken promptly upon recollection. Complete the entire treatment regimen, even with symptom improvement; premature cessation can compromise efficacy. Common side effects include nausea, vomiting, diarrhea, and dyspepsia. Report worsening side effects immediately. Seek urgent medical attention for allergic reactions (e.g., rash, pruritus, edema, dyspnea). Inform your doctor of all concurrent medications, and pregnant or lactating individuals should consult their physician before use. Alcohol should be avoided due to potential increased drowsiness. While generally non-impairing to driving ability, refrain from driving if experiencing somnolence or dizziness. Adequate rest, nutritious food, and hydration promote faster recovery. Your physician may order laboratory tests to monitor treatment efficacy.

How Cefkri-AZ Tablet works:
Cefkri-AZ Tablets contain Cefixime, Azithromycin, and Lactobacillus, working synergistically to combat infection. Cefixime, an antibiotic, inhibits bacterial cell wall synthesis, disrupting bacterial survival. Azithromycin, another antibiotic, blocks protein synthesis vital for bacterial function, halting their growth. This combined antibiotic action effectively eliminates the infection. Lactobacillus, a probiotic, replenishes beneficial intestinal bacteria potentially disrupted by antibiotics or infection, promoting gut health.
SAFETY ADVICE
AlcoholUNSAFE
Concurrent alcohol ingestion and Cefkri-AZ Tablet use is contraindicated.
Preg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
Data on Cefkri-AZ Tablet use in pregnancy are lacking. Seek medical advice from your physician.
Breast feedingSAFE IF PRESCRIBED
Lactation is compatible with Cefkri-AZ Tablet use. Research in humans indicates minimal drug transfer to breast milk, posing no known risk to infants.
DrivingSAFE
Driving ability is typically unaffected by Cefkri-AZ Tablet.
KidneyCAUTION
Patients with kidney impairment should exercise caution when using Cefkri-AZ Tablets, as dosage modification may be necessary. A physician's consultation is recommended.
LiverCAUTION
Patients with liver impairment should use Cefkri-AZ Tablets cautiously, potentially requiring dosage modification. Physician consultation is advised.
What if you forget to take Cefkri-AZ Tablet :
Should you forget a Cefkri-AZ Tablet dose, administer it promptly. Nevertheless, if your next dose is imminent, omit the missed one and resume your usual dosing regimen. Avoid taking a double dose.
